Stefanik Stays

  • Elise Stefanik's Nomination Withdrawal: President Donald Trump withdrew Representative Elise Stefanik's nomination as the UN ambassador to maintain the Republican Party's narrow majority in the House of Representatives. The decision was strategic to avoid a special election that could jeopardize the GOP's ability to pass key legislation.
  • Political Context: At the time, Republicans held a slim majority (218 to 213) in the House, with four vacant seats. Stefanik's departure could have risked losing control of the House.
  • Support from Party Leaders: House Speaker Mike Johnson supported the decision, emphasizing Stefanik's vital role in advancing the party's legislative priorities. Stefanik had previously stepped down from her position as chair of the House Republican Conference in anticipation of her ambassadorial appointment.

More Student Visas Revoked

  • ICE Crackdown on Foreign Students: The Trump administration increased arrests of foreign students, particularly those involved in pro-Palestinian protests. Examples include a doctoral student at the University of Alabama and a Turkish student at Tufts University.
  • Legal Basis: The administration used a law allowing the Secretary of State to deport non-citizens who threaten the nation's foreign policy. The crackdown targeted students allegedly supporting terrorist organizations like Hamas.
  • Public Reaction: The University of Alabama and College Democrats expressed concerns about the impact on the international community. The administration defended its actions as necessary for national security.

Tesla Terrorist Take Down

  • Attacks on Tesla Properties: Recent investigations led to arrests related to attacks on Tesla service centers and vehicles. Examples include:
    • Las Vegas: A 36-year-old man was arrested for arson and possession of an explosive device after attacking a Tesla service center.
    • Texarkana: A 33-year-old man was arrested for running his all-terrain vehicle into parked Teslas, identified through Tesla's Century Mode footage.
  • Law Enforcement Efforts: The arrests highlight the effectiveness of collaborative efforts between law enforcement agencies and the role of technology in ensuring public safety.
  • Pam Bondi's Statement: Pam Bondi emphasized the seriousness of these attacks and the administration's commitment to pursuing maximum penalties for those involved.
